Gujarat presents Rs 3.55 bn deficit Budget

The Gujarat's Budget for 2002-2003 projects a deficit of Rs 3.55 billion.

Presenting the Budget in the state assembly on Wednesday, the Gujarat Finance Minister Nitin Patel said that as against the estimated revenue expenditure of Rs 241.65 billion, the revenue receipts were Rs 166.95 billion.

Revenue account deficit has reached Rs 54.70 billion even as the capital account surplus is pegged at Rs 43.68 billion, the minister added.
